    What do I do If my Drive Does not have a + and - DIR and PUL, It only say PUL, DIR, OPTO and ENA is a DM322E microstep driver. Also can you Connect two drivers to a single PLC? My PLC has a [3L+ 3M .0 .1 .2 .3]

    • @IndeeSac
      @IndeeSac  Před rokem

      Hi Jose, regarding your type of driver, in these cases they are usually negative pulse, that is, your plc must output NPN, in the OPTO you place +24V, and in PUL and DIR with resistance to the respective pulse outputs.
      With respect to your plc according to its model, see if it comes out NPN or PNP at its output.

    are the resistors necessary? and what happends if i don't use resistors?

    • @IndeeSac
      @IndeeSac  Před rokem

      Hi, yes it is necessary because the output of the plc transistor gives you 24 volts and the controller needs 10 or 5 volts, if you do not place it you can damage your driver.
